Exhibition, November 2006

Signs of the Times, and Textile Tidbits is an exhibition Bill Bottomley and I held at the Wollombi Cultural Centre in Novemebr/December 2006. Bill featured over 12o posters he has created, as well as a number of framed digital images. I showed a number of woven items, ranging from wall hangingsm, rugs, scarves, and bags to pace mats, and table runners.

Here are some of the items I displayed, and some images of the gallery while the exhibition was on.
